Full-arch dental restoration in Vietnam typically costs from AUD $12,143 to AUD $21,144. Final prices depend on the chosen implant brand, the grade of zirconia used, and necessary preparatory surgeries. Australians save approximately 62% compared to local private fees, which average AUD $44,002. Costs usually include six titanium implants, surgical placement, and a high-strength monolithic zirconia bridge.
